For bronchitis caused by bacteria, treatments will include the usage of antibiotics. There are many bacteria which cause disorders and illnesses. Bronchitis is a common disease amongst adults and children. Mycoplasma pneumonia causes bronchitis. It's a minute bacterium which belongs to the Mollicutes class. Unlike the other bacteria which have cell walls, this type doesn't have any. It's composed of a single membrane which incorporates compounds. The Antibiotics, especially the beta-lactam, and the penicillin disrupts the cell wall; and so it shouldn't be used for treating mycoplasma pneumonia as it lacks cell walls. When these bacterial infections occur inside a person having bronchitis, its usually treated using antibiotics and must take the medication which is prescribed. The infection might return if these antibiotics are stopped. Many people stop these antibiotics when they start feeling better; but this must not be done as these bacterial infections will return. You've to strictly follow the doctor's prescription for killing all living bacteria and prevent these diseases from returning.
If the bronchitis is due to M. pneumonia, it might be identified easily due to the sluggish progression of its symptoms, blood test over cold-hemaglutinins with a positive result, lack of bacteria in a sputum sample ( sample is gram stained), and it lacks growth blood agar. Chronic bronchitis is defined as a long term inflammation or swelling of the bronchi.' This can result in heightened production of mucus and may be accompanied by other side effects.' To be classified as chronic bronchitis, a harsh cough and expectoration (coughing up of mucus) must occur on most days, for no less than three months of the year, for two or more years in a row.'
